post_previewFor our move from Charlotte to Spokane we decided to eliminate a lot of our furniture that we deemed was not a “favorite.”  So we arrive out west with no kitchen table, tv stand, or bookshelves.  We went furniture shopping at Dania Furniture this past week and saw some very cool stuff and stuff we would like to buy, but not in our current price range.  My sister-in-law had just had custom cabinets put in their house and I figured it might be worth reaching out to someone locally to build a piece of furniture.

I found a contact from Craigslist and scheduled a time to meet on Monday but he asked for me to get some images of what we like.  With not a lot on our plates in Spokane I had time to play around in Google SketchUp and build the “ideal” furniture.  I have been playing around with the colors and fabrics and ultimately those will all change when the final design but I wanted to throw up the concept I was working on.  It has sliding panels that normally are made of glass, but I thought it would look cool to have a fabric panel which you can update easily for a completely different look down the road.  Anyways, less rambling and follow the jump for the photos.
